Note fo o Bluetooth Manager must be active in order for you to be able to use Bluetooth Local COM. + Clients and servers When Bluetooth wireless technology communications are performed, there will always be a “client/server” relationship between the various devices. A “client” is a device that sends certain requests to another device. while a “server” is a device that provides a service on receipt of such requests from another device.
